For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 345 students in the neighborhood of South Woodstock, Woodstock, CT.
The top-ranked public school in South Woodstock is Woodstock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of South Woodstock, Woodstock, CT public school have an average math proficiency score of 28% (versus the Connecticut public school average of 42%), and reading proficiency score of 56% (versus the 51%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 11%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Connecticut public school average of 54% (majority Hispanic).
